广州市外贸网站建设服务机构,微信网站建设价格,页面设计属于什么专业,域名注册技巧我们学习了解了这么多关于PHP的知识#xff0c;不知道你们对PHP中关于is#xff0c;between#xff0c;in等运算符的用法是什么#xff1f;是否已经完全掌握了呢#xff0c;如果没有#xff0c;那就跟随本篇文章一起继续学习吧
相关推荐#xff1a;关于PHP中的增删改如…我们学习了解了这么多关于PHP的知识不知道你们对PHP中关于isbetweenin等运算符的用法是什么是否已经完全掌握了呢如果没有那就跟随本篇文章一起继续学习吧
相关推荐关于PHP中的增删改如何运用
is 运算符:空值和布尔值的判断
有4种情况的使用: xx is null:判断某个字段是“null”值——就是没有值,xxis not null:判断某个字段不是“null”值 xx is true:判断某个字段为“真”《true xxis false:判断某个字段为“假”false: o0.0,“. null 所谓布尔值其实是tinyint(1)这个类型的一个“别名”本质上只是判断一个数字是否为0
between运算符:范围判断
用于判断某个字段的数据值是否在某个给定的范围――适用于数字类型,
语法:
xxbetween值1and值2,含义:
XX字段的值在给定“值1”和“值2”之间其实相当于:XX值1 and xx 值2
in运算符:给定确定数据的范围判断
语法:
xxin(值1值2值3...-.);含义﹔
表示字段XX的值为所列出的这些值中的一个就算是涡足了条件﹔这些值通常是零散无规律的。
它罗列出的数据如果有一定的规律则其实可以使用逻辑运算符或between运算符来代替。
like运算符:对字符串进行模糊查找
语法:
xX like‘要查找的内容
常见示例及含义: name like“%罗%: 表示nam中“罗”这一个字的所有数据行, name like“罗%心: 表示nam中以“罗”开头的所有数据行,比如:罗兰 name like“%罗; 表示nam中以“罗”结尾的所有数据行﹔比如:c罗魂斗罗 namelike·罗_: 表示nam中以“罗”开头并只有2个字符的所有数据行,比如:罗兰 name like·_罗: 表示nam中以“罗”结尾并只有2个字符的所有数据行,比如:c罗 一个新的问题:
如果我要找某个字段中含“%《或_〉的行怎么办?转义就ok :
间%:表示%这个字符本身
L_:表示_这个字符本身例;
xX like“%9%69% ;
表示XX中含有百分号%〉这个字符的所有行,
相关学习推荐mysql教程(视频)
以上就是PHP中关于isbetweenin等运算符的用法是什么